Ghost Quartet – music, lyrics, and text by Dave Malloy
directed by William Thomas Hodgson

Dave Malloy’s quirky and wondrous ghost story musical is as life-affirming as it is astounding. The piece is author-described as “a song cycle about love, death, and whiskey” in which “a camera breaks and four friends drink in four interwoven narratives spanning seven centuries.”

Audiences won’t want to miss this stunning musical from the creator whose work has recently delighted Bay Area audiences at Berkeley Rep (Octet) and Shotgun Players (Natasha, Pierre and the Great Comet of 1812), with Ghost Quartet what many consider to be his most enchanting work.

The cast includes award-winning artist Rinde Eckert (piano, organ, slide guitar, percussion, vocals), an inaugural Doris Duke Artist (2012), recipient of an Alpert Award (2009), Guggenheim Fellowship (2007), and a Marc Blitzstein Award (2005), and a 2007 finalist for the Pulitzer Prize in Drama. Eckert is joined by Ami Nashimoto (cello, ukulele, erhu, percussion, vocals), Veronica Renner (accordion, autoharp, percussion, vocals), Monica Rose Slater (glockenspiel, accordion, harp, percussion, vocals), and Michael Perez (percussion, vocals).

“Halloween is the perfect time for a ghost story,” said Director and OTP Co-Artistic Director William Thomas Hodgson, “and the show enraptures you. In the stories that overlap, all these iterations of ghosts relate to each other. It’s a meditation on many different types of ghosts, like the ghost of regret, a past lover, a mistake, a thing that haunts you—or a literal ghost, an apparition. It’s also about love, betrayal, and keeping memories alive—and all of that is encapsulated in a ghost story.”

Ghost Quartet marks the exciting first co-production between Oakland Theater Project and New Performance Traditions!

Created by the Paul Dresher Ensemble, New Performance Traditions is a dynamic hub for nurturing multidisciplinary arts projects from conception to production, performance, and recording. We are dedicated to fostering daring and innovative performing artworks while providing unwavering support to the visionary artists who create them. We support and incubate the next generation of creative performing artists by providing affordable access to rehearsal and production spaces, professional equipment, video recording and live-streaming technologies, and performance opportunities and by offering multi-week residencies, production stipends, technical mentorship, and fiscal sponsorship to emerging and mid-career artists.

Oakland Theater Project’s mission is to create exquisite theatrical experiences to inspire compassion and forge bonds across socio-economic and racial barriers. Oakland Theater Project was founded in 2012 by Michael Socrates Moran, William Hodgson, and Colin Mandlin in Oakland, CA, and produces year-round professional theater for Oakland and the Bay Area. Rooted in Oakland, OTP’s work explores how theater can act as a vehicle to reveal and invigorate the latent interconnectedness in society.
